By definition, solar decommissioning refers to the planned and systematic retirement of solar power systems, involving the safe removal and management of components at the end of their operational life. This process aims to ensure environmental sustainability and compliance with regulations. Typically, solar farms are designed to function effectively for 20-25 years before performance degradation leads to their retirement. Disposal: Where panels are. . What is the environmental life cycle assessment of PV systems?
Environmental Life Cycle Assessment of Electricity from PV Systems This fact sheet provides an overview of the environmental life cycle assessment (LCA) of photovoltaic (PV) systems. It outlines the stages from manufacturing to end-of-life management, focusing on an average residential PV system.
What is the environmental impact of solar power systems?
The environmental impact of solar power systems mainly arises during the production and disposal phases. As solar panels have a lifespan of 20 to 30 years, their disposal at the end of their life cycle poses a significant challenge.
What are the environmental impacts of PV systems?
The environmental impact of PV systems has improved markedly compared to 2015 values, particularly in non-renewable energy payback time. Increased panel efficiency, reducing life cycle environmental impacts. Decreased kerf loss and reduced poly-Si demand, lowering overall impacts.
How do photovoltaic panels affect the environment?
Essentially, the installation of photovoltaic panels can impact surface water, heat exchange, and energy balance, leading to spatial and temporal variations in environmental effects within the photovoltaic field (Jiang et al., 2021).
